设为首页收藏本站Access中国

Office中国论坛/Access中国论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

返回列表 发新帖
查看: 1305|回复: 3
打印 上一主题 下一主题

[模块/函数] 把文件存进access数据库然后取出来供人下载的代码(取自e-office部分模块)

[复制链接]
跳转到指定楼层
1#
发表于 2002-9-21 01:25:00 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
senddate.asp(发送界面)<form&nbsp;method="post"&nbsp;ENCTYPE="multipart/form-data"&nbsp;name="form3"&nbsp;action="senddateindb.asp">
<input&nbsp;type="hidden"&nbsp;name="userdept"&nbsp;value="<%=firstdept%>">
<input&nbsp;type="hidden"&nbsp;name="username"&nbsp;value="所有人">
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td&nbsp;align="center"><b>发给:</b></td><td><input&nbsp;type="text"&nbsp;name="sendto"&nbsp;size=60&nbsp;value="<%=sendto%>"&nbsp;onfocus="document.form3.title.focus();"><font&nbsp;color=red>*</font></td>
&nbsp;&nbsp;&nbsp;&nbsp;</tr>
&nbsp;&nbsp;&nbsp;&nbsp;<tr>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td&nbsp;align="center"><b>标题:</b></td>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td><input&nbsp;type=text&nbsp;name="title"&nbsp;size=60><font&nbsp;color=red>*</font></td>
&nbsp;&nbsp;&nbsp;&nbsp;</tr>
&nbsp;&nbsp;&nbsp;&nbsp;<tr>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td&nbsp;align="center"><b>内容:</b></td>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td><textarea&nbsp;name="content"&nbsp;rows="9"&nbsp;cols="60"></textarea></td>
&nbsp;&nbsp;&nbsp;&nbsp;</tr>
&nbsp;&nbsp;&nbsp;&nbsp;<tr>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td&nbsp;align="center"><b>附件:</b></td>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td><input&nbsp;type="file"&nbsp;name="file1"&nbsp;size=35>(不能超过100K)</td>
&nbsp;&nbsp;&nbsp;&nbsp;</tr>
&nbsp;&nbsp;&nbsp;&nbsp;<tr>
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<td&nbsp;align=center&nbsp;colspan=2>
<input&nbsp;type="submit"&nbsp;name="submit"&nbsp;value="发送">
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;</td>
</form>*************************************************************************
senddateindb.asp(把要发送的文件保存到数据库)<!--#INCLUDE&nbsp;FILE="asp/fupload.inc"-->
<!--#include&nbsp;file="asp/opendb.asp"-->
<!--#include&nbsp;file="asp/sqlstr.asp"-->
<!--#include&nbsp;file="asp/checked.asp"-->
<!--#include&nbsp;file="asp/bgsub.asp"-->
<%
'On&nbsp;Error&nbsp;Resume&nbsp;Next
oabusyname=request.cookies("oabusyname")
oabusyusername=request.cookies("oabusyusername")
oabusyuserdept=request.cookies("oabusyuserdept")
oabusyuserlevel=request.cookies("oabusyuserlevel")
if&nbsp;oabusyusername=""&nbsp;then&nbsp;response.redirect&nbsp;"default.asp"
%>
<html>
<head>
<meta&nbsp;http-equiv="Content-Type"&nbsp;content="text/html;&nbsp;charset=gb2312">
<meta&nbsp;name="GENERATOR"&nbsp;content="Microsoft&nbsp;FrontPage&nbsp;4.0">
<meta&nbsp;name="rogId"&nbsp;content="FrontPage.Editor.Document">
<link&nbsp;rel="stylesheet"&nbsp;href="css/css.css">
<title>企业管理系统</title>
</head>
<body&nbsp;bgcolor="#eeeeee"&nbsp;topmargin="5"&nbsp;leftmargin="5">
<%
call&nbsp;bghead()
%>
<center>
<table>
<tr>
<td>
<b>公文发送</b>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;
</td>
<form&nbsp;action="senddate.asp"&nbsp;method="post"&nbsp;name="form1">
<td>
<input&nbsp;type="submit"&nbsp;value="返回">
</td>
</form>
</tr>
</table>
</center>
<%
call&nbsp;bgmid()
%><%
if&nbsp;Request.ServerVariables("REQUEST_METHOD")&nbsp;=&nbsp;"OST"&nbsp;Then
'---------------------------
'response.write&nbsp;"开始发送<br>"
'---------------------------
Dim&nbsp;Fields
UploadSizeLimit=100000
Set&nbsp;Fields&nbsp;=&nbsp;GetUpload()
dim&nbsp;Field
For&nbsp;Each&nbsp;Field&nbsp;In&nbsp;Fields.Items
if&nbsp;Field.name="title"&nbsp;then&nbsp;title=BinaryToString(Field.value)
if&nbsp;Field.name="content"&nbsp;then&nbsp;content=BinaryToString(Field.value)
if&nbsp;Field.name="sendto"&nbsp;then&nbsp;sendto=BinaryToString(Field.value)
if&nbsp;Field.name="file1"&nbsp;then
filename=field.FileName
fileContentType=field.ContentType
filevalue=field.value
end&nbsp;if
next
'--------------------------------------
'response.write&nbsp;"title="&nbsp;&&nbsp;title&nbsp;&&nbsp;"<br>"
'response.write&nbsp;"content="&nbsp;&&nbsp;content&nbsp;&&nbsp;"<br>"
'response.write&nbsp;"sendto="&nbsp;&&nbsp;sendto&nbsp;&&nbsp;"<br>"
'response.write&nbsp;"filedname="&nbsp;&&nbsp;filename&nbsp;&&nbsp;"<br>"
'response.write&nbsp;"fileContentType="&nbsp;&&nbsp;fileContentType&nbsp;&&nbsp;"<br>"
'------------------
分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
收藏收藏 分享分享 分享淘帖 订阅订阅
2#
发表于 2002-9-22 07:06:00 | 只看该作者
严重支持!
3#
发表于 2002-9-23 02:32:00 | 只看该作者
不知这样做有什么好处?
4#
 楼主| 发表于 2002-9-23 17:24:00 | 只看该作者
如果是网中!大家可以用access进行数据交换!
多想!想!!
您需要登录后才可以回帖 登录 | 注册

本版积分规则

QQ|站长邮箱|小黑屋|手机版|Office中国/Access中国 ( 粤ICP备10043721号-1 )  

GMT+8, 2024-5-5 18:01 , Processed in 0.130085 second(s), 27 queries .

Powered by Discuz! X3.3

© 2001-2017 Comsenz Inc.

快速回复 返回顶部 返回列表